Caldwell County to vote on 2nd Amendment Sanctuary

Caldwell County Commissioners are expected to be next in line to vote on a proposed resolution to make the county a 2nd Amendment Sanctuary during its regular meeting tonight.  The resolution states  the Caldwell County Board of Commissioners wishes to express its intent to stand as a Sanctuary County for Second Amendment rights and to oppose any efforts to unconstitutionally restrict such rights.  Several counties around the area have already voted to become 2nd Amendment Sanctuary Counties.
